YSK That if you delete your lemmy account, your comments/posts made on other instances will remain there forever.

So say I make an account on lemmy.world and post a bunch of stupid comments around other instances then decide to delete my account because I'm ashamed of them. After I delete my account, a copy of all those comments I made on other instances remain on those instances as a "shadow copy." There isn't any way to actually delete them all. The copies of the comments/posts on your home instance will be deleted
tldr: Don't say stupid shit on other instances you'll regret later! They never leave that instance!
Why YSK: so you can think carefully about what to comment and post.
